Field Application & Operational Analysis

From a Site Reliability Engineer’s perspective, the Bently Nevada 330980-51-05 Proximitor Sensor is a cornerstone component in mission-critical machinery protection systems. Engineered as part of the 3300 XL platform, the 330980-51-05 delivers factory-calibrated eddy-current proximity measurement that directly contributes to system availability — reducing unplanned downtime on turbines, compressors, and high-speed rotating equipment. Its seamless integration into existing I/O Modules and DCS architectures makes it a preferred choice for process optimization across power generation and oil & gas facilities.

Durability under harsh industrial conditions is a defining characteristic of this unit. The 330980-51-05 operates reliably across a temperature range of -40°C to +85°C, with an integral 5-meter cable that eliminates field-side connector failure points — a common vulnerability in high-vibration environments. Installation teams should ensure proper grounding and cable routing away from high-EMI sources to maintain signal integrity. The thin-profile DIN-rail mounting format supports high-density panel configurations without compromising accessibility for maintenance cycles.

Maintenance & Performance Benchmarks

The 330980-51-05 is engineered to adapt across diverse industrial network architectures — from standalone single-machine monitoring setups to enterprise-scale distributed control systems with hundreds of measurement points. In small-to-mid-scale installations, the sensor interfaces directly with Bently Nevada monitors via standard coaxial cabling, providing plug-and-play deployment with minimal commissioning overhead.

For large-scale facilities integrating the 330980-51-05 into multi-tier SCADA or DCS environments, the sensor’s consistent output characteristics simplify calibration management across channels. Maintenance benchmarks indicate that units operating within specified temperature and vibration envelopes demonstrate service intervals exceeding 5 years without recalibration. Periodic verification against a reference standard is recommended annually as part of a predictive maintenance program aligned with API 670 fourth edition guidelines.

When replacing a failed unit, technicians should document the gap voltage at installation (typically -10.0 VDC at 2.0 mm gap for standard targets) to establish a baseline for future condition trending. This practice supports long-term process optimization and early fault detection within the machinery protection architecture.

Comprehensive Data Sheet

Attribute Technical Data
Full Model Number 330980-51-05
Brand Bently Nevada
Series 3300 XL Proximitor
Product Type Proximitor Sensor (Eddy-Current)
Cable Length 5 meters (16.4 ft) — Integral
Mounting Style Thin Profile DIN-Rail / Panel Mount
Output Sensitivity -7.87 V/mm (-200 mV/mil) nominal
Frequency Response 0 to 10 kHz (-3 dB)
Operating Temperature -40°C to +85°C (-40°F to +185°F)
Supply Voltage -24 VDC (nominal)
Compliance Standards API 670, ISO 20816
Weight 0.255 kg

Engineering Support & FAQ

Q1: What are the installation steps for the 330980-51-05 in a 3300 XL monitoring system?
Mount the sensor on a DIN-rail or panel surface within the control cabinet. Connect the integral 5m cable to the corresponding Bently Nevada monitor input channel using the standard coaxial connector. Set the gap distance to the target (typically 2.0 mm for standard steel targets) and verify the gap voltage reads approximately -10.0 VDC. No field calibration is required — the unit is factory-calibrated and ready for immediate commissioning.

Q2: Which firmware versions and monitor models are compatible with the 330980-51-05?
The 330980-51-05 is compatible with all 3300 XL series monitors, including the 3300/16, 3300/20, and 3300/46 configurations. It also interfaces with Bently Nevada System 1 software for condition monitoring and diagnostics. No firmware-specific dependencies exist at the sensor level — compatibility is governed by the monitor’s channel configuration.

Q6: Is the 330980-51-05 suitable for use in hazardous area (Ex) classified zones?
The standard 330980-51-05 is rated for general industrial environments. For deployment in ATEX, IECEx, or NEC hazardous area classifications, a certified intrinsic safety barrier or galvanic isolator must be installed in the signal circuit.
